How can carved wood be securely attached?

The carvings can be most easily attached using wood glue (D2 or D3). The surface must be cleaned and dusted beforehand. If mechanical fixing is necessary, small brads or wire nails can be used. Sink the nail heads below the wood surface and patch with wood filler so the surface remains smooth.

How should the surface of the carvings be treated?

Carved wood is sold in a natural, untreated state, so you can decide how to finish it. Painting, staining, glaze, or silk-gloss varnish are all good solutions. The floral details can be beautifully highlighted with thin, multiple layers of glaze. Always work on a dust-free surface and use a small brush.

What common mistakes should be avoided when installing the rossette?

In cabinetmaker projects, sometimes trial fitting of carved wood is not performed before gluing, which results in inaccurate positioning. During door renovation, it is advisable to first fit the rossette dry. Do not use too much glue as the excess is difficult to remove after drying. For securing, it is recommended to use a clamp or weight and allow the full drying time.

Cultural history: floral motif and rossette in furniture decoration

These decorative elements appeared in ancient architecture and on Renaissance furniture as well. The circular shape symbolized unity and harmony. Among wood carvings, this motif has remained one of the most widespread on classicist and baroque furniture. Cabinetmaker masters often used the rossette as a central element in decorating cabinets and door frames.
